What is FSI Construction?

FSI Construction
ConstructionConstruction Management

Established in 2004, FSI Construction operates as a premier general contractor with a specialized focus on the multifamily housing market. The firm has successfully executed nearly 10,000 projects across 20 states, establishing a reputation for value-engineered solutions and high-quality workmanship. Beyond standard construction, the company provides critical due diligence and disaster recovery services, making it an essential partner for property owners and institutional managers. How much funding has FSI Construction raised?

FSI Construction has raised a total of $1.1M across 2 funding rounds:

2020

Debt

$1M

2021

Debt

$118K

Debt (2020): $1M with participation from PPP

Debt (2021): $118K led by PPP
